Travel Score in 18444, Moscow, Pennsylvania

The Travel Score for the Hypertension Score in 18444, Moscow, Pennsylvania is 64 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

67.23 percent of residents in 18444 to travel to work in 30 minutes or less.

When looking at the three closest hospitals, the average distance to a hospital is 7.64 miles. The closest hospital with an emergency room is Geisinger-Community Medical Center with a distance of 7.19 miles from the area.

**Drive Time Dynamics**

For residents of Moscow, PA, the primary mode of transportation is the personal vehicle. The landscape, characterized by rolling hills and dispersed populations, necessitates a car for most errands, including healthcare visits.

The closest major healthcare hub is Scranton, approximately 15 miles east. Reaching Scranton typically involves traveling along **Interstate 380 (I-380)**, a well-maintained highway offering a relatively smooth and efficient commute. During off-peak hours, the drive can be completed in under 20 minutes. However, during rush hour, particularly in the morning and evening, traffic congestion can add significant time, potentially extending the commute to 30-40 minutes.

Another option is to travel along **Route 6**, which offers a more scenic route but is often slower due to its two-lane configuration and potential for traffic delays. **Route 6** is an option, especially if you are traveling to the west.

**Healthcare Access: Destination Considerations**

Several healthcare providers serve the Scranton area, including Geisinger Commonwealth Health System, offering a range of specialties and services, including cardiology, endocrinology, and nephrology, all vital for hypertension management. The **Geisinger Community Medical Center** is a key destination.

**Lackawanna County** also boasts several urgent care facilities, providing immediate care for non-life-threatening conditions. These facilities can be crucial for managing acute hypertension episodes or addressing medication-related issues.

**Public Transit: Limited Options**

Public transportation options in Moscow and the surrounding areas are limited. The **Lackawanna County Transportation Authority (LCTA)** provides bus services, but these routes are infrequent and primarily serve the Scranton area.

Currently, there are no direct LCTA bus routes that originate within Moscow. Residents would likely need to drive to a designated pick-up point, such as the **Moscow Post Office** and then transfer to a bus that can take you to Scranton.

The LCTA buses do have ADA (Americans with Disabilities Act) accessibility features, including ramps and designated seating for individuals with disabilities. However, the infrequent schedules and the need for transfers can pose significant challenges for individuals with mobility limitations or those requiring frequent medical appointments.

**Ride-Sharing and Medical Transport**

Ride-sharing services, such as Uber and Lyft, are available in the Scranton area. However, their availability in Moscow can be less consistent, particularly during off-peak hours or in inclement weather. The cost of ride-sharing can also be a significant factor, especially for frequent medical appointments.

Medical transportation services are available. These services are specifically designed to transport individuals to and from medical appointments. They often provide door-to-door service and can accommodate individuals with mobility limitations. However, these services can be costly and may require advance booking.
